(ANSA) - TURIN, OCT 30 - A 42-year-old car salesman with a
criminal record was arrested Friday on suspicion of tying,
gagging and murdering a 60-year-old accountant and financial
consultant in the hills above Turin on the night of June 8-9,
police said.
Police said the alleged murderer knew the victim, Luciano
Ollino, and rented a flat from him at Pecetto Torinese.
Police said the motive for the murder was a disagreement over
the sale of a piece of property.
Ollino was tied up and gagged before being shot six times inside
his car, a BMW, found in a layby between Turin and Moncalieri.
To provide himself with an alibi the suspected murderer left
Piedmont that night for southern Italy, police said. (ANSA).
